In the quiet winter of 1969, a 23-year-old white female college student named Mary Ann Wysocki embarked on what was meant to be a relaxing weekend getaway to Provincetown, Massachusetts, with her friend, Patricia Walsh, also 23. The two friends from Providence, Rhode Island, checked into a local guesthouse, where they crossed paths with a 24-year-old handyman named Antone "Tony" Costa, who was also staying there. After a night out, the two women were never seen alive again.
